Anybody here get a sig P365 yet? I must have been living under a rock because I had never heard of it until a couple days ago. Looking at the specs it looked very good being almost the exact same size and weight as my LC9s pro I currently carry. I went to gander mountain yesterday to get my mitts on one and I was extremely impressed with it.
It feels bigger in the hand than my LC9s does as the grip is a little fatter and less shapely due to the double stack mag. Its not very rounded off and scultped, it feels more like a glock 42 in size and shape due to the blocky slide and grip, but I think with the right holster it shouldn't print to bad in a front pocket. The salesguy let me try putting it in my front pocket and it felt fine and extracted easily. Comes with night sights now and the sight picture looked really nice. The slide spring is really heavy but that will not be a problem for me as I have strong hands.
Now one of the most important things for me on a gun is the trigger. The trigger on just about all micro 9mm's I've tried are pretty bad in my opinion. The LC9s is the only one I've ever shot that had what I would call a good trigger. I shoot my LC9s alot and shoot it very well thanks to the excellent trigger. A couple weeks ago I was ringing a 12" plate with it at 75 yards. Well the trigger on this P365 was just awesome. Its a little heavier than an lc9s, felt like mabey 5 pounds, but there was a good bit less travel to break and a shorter reset. I could tell from dry firing it in the store that I will likely be able to shoot this just as well as I do my lc9s.
